Overview of the Role:
We are seeking a Media Relations Executive to help retain and expand the presence of Newswire clients' press releases in the media. The Media Relations team focuses on strengthening and growing our distribution network across Europe, the Middle East, Africa, and India, ensuring maximum reach for our customers’ press releases.
What We’re Looking For:
- Professional with experience in Media Research and PR.
- Deep understanding of the UK and EMEA media landscapes.
- Excellent written, verbal, and interpersonal communication skills.
- Motivated, strong team player.
- Fluent in an additional European language (German, Spanish or Italian preferred).
Key Responsibilities:
- Maintain and expand the presence of our news feeds on target websites.
- Strengthen and enhance the media subscription base on our PR Newswire for Journalists platform.
- Manage assigned social media accounts.
- Respond promptly and accurately to sales queries.
- Contribute to departmental tasks and projects, ensuring timely and successful completion.
- Uphold and maintain quality standards of service.
